You operate a factory that produces beach towels.Your current level of output equals 2,000 towels per week.Your weekly variable cost equals $8,000.If your total cost each week equals $9,000,it follows that:
A) the average variable cost of production equals $2 per towel.
B) the average variable cost of production equals $4 per towel.
C) the average total cost of production equals $8 per towel.
D) none of the above
